March 12, 2008

The sassy dolls known as Bratz will star in their first animated musical slated to debut during a one-day special event on Saturday, April 19 at selected movie theatres across the US before launching on DVD this fall.

Bratz: Girlz Really Rock follows the girls as they head to Camp Starshine and wind up producing an in-camp talent show.

Tickets for this event are available at presenting theatre box offices and online at www.FathomEvents.com.

Presented by National CineMedia’s (NCM) Fathom, in partnership with Lionsgate and MGA Entertainment, the in-theatre even will also showcase a never-before-seen interview with daughter of MGA Entertainment CEO Isaac Larian, Jasmin Larian; she’s the namesake of the Bratz character Yasmin.

The Bratz brand launched 2001, and more than 150 million dolls have been sold to date.
